Important Summary from the Employee Handbook

 

  1. Unpaid Meal Break: 30-minute unpaid meal break if you work more than 6 hours in a calendar day. 
  2. Earned Sick Time: earn 1 hour for every 30 hours worked up to 40 hours per year. 
  3. Clock in/out: Before & after work on your scheduled time. 
  4. Unexcused absenteeism & tardiness: Termination after warnings. 3 days in a row of no show/no call will be considered a resignation. 
  5. Conduct and Behavior: Always Be professional; you represent Bay State Linen. Profanities or cursing are not allowed. No smoking/vaping/drinking alcohol while you are working. 
  6. Theft: We are committed to creating a place built on trust, integrity, and responsibility. Please remember that stealing is a very serious offense. Taking anything that belongs to the company, another employee, or a customer will result in immediate termination. Please review the Employee Handbook.   
  7. Food and drinks: NOT allowed inside the plant. Bottled water is allowed away from machines and laundry. 
  8. Dress code: Closed and comfortable flat shoes with grips. No offensive or vulgar clothing. Wear your uniform while working. 
  9. Safety: No phones or air pods while on the job for safety and awareness with the exception of managers, support and service representatives for work communications. Pull back hair in a bun and no lose belts or clothing that could get caught in machines or linens. For Service Representatives, phones must be properly mounted and used in "hands-free" mode with eyes on the road at all times and hands on the wheels. Follow road/driving and parking rules (such as turning off the vehicle, putting on the brakes, taking the keys with you and locking the vehicle - never leave the key in the vehicle). 
  10. Lock Out Tag Out (LOTO) Training: Watch the LOTO Training Video https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=TSrzftGx4d0 required before using any of the machines. Only authorized employees are allowed to repair and maintain the machines. They must follow the LOTO procedures.

Lock Out Tag Out Procedures

All Employees MUST go through a Lock Out Tag Out Training at the start of their employment and annually and sign the acknowledgement form that they went through training and understand their responsibilities. Only authorized employees are allowed to repair or maintain the machines. They need to follow the steps below: 

Before performing any repairs or maintenance work on the machine/equipment: 

  1. COMPLETE THE LOCK OUT TAG OUT FORM online before starting. 
  2. PREPARE: Identify all sources of energy - electrical, pneumatic/air pressure, steam, hydraulic, mechanical, etc. and locate isolation devices. See the photos above. 
  3. NOTIFY: Inform all affected employees of the work and the machine involved. 
  4. SHUT DOWN MACHINE: Turn off the machine properly to prevent hazards.  
  5. ISOLATE ENERGY SOURCES: Use breakers, valves, switches to isolate the machine from its energy source. 
  6. LOCK & TAG: Authorized employees must apply personal locks and tags to energy isolating devices to prevent re-energization. See the photos above. 
  7. RELEASE STORED ENERGY: Deenergize/dissipate/remove/restrain any remaining/residual energy stored in the machine. 
  8. VERIFY: Ensure no person is around to test the machine is unpowered and cannot start by trying the start button. Confirm that the machine is fully off and safe to work on.  

After the work is done: 

  1. Remove any tools or parts and put safety covers or guards back in place.  
  2. Take off the lock(s) and tag (s). 
  3. Re-energize the machine. 
  4. Notify all affected employees that the machine is ready and safe to use again.

Paid Family and Medical Leave

Paid Family and Medical Leave

Paid Family and Medical Leave

If you qualify for both unemployment benefits and paid leave, the amount in paid leave benefits that you are eligible for will be reduced by any unemployment benefits you collect during your leave. Any unemployment benefits collected prior to your family or medical leave beginning will not affect your paid leave benefit amount.


If you are making a claim for paid leave and worker’s compensation about the same injury or incident that you are requesting to take paid leave for, the amount you receive in paid leave benefits may be reduced by the amount you receive in weekly worker’s compensation wage replacement benefits. If the workplace injury you’re receiving worker’s compensation benefits for occurred prior to your paid leave claim, OR if the 2 incidents are independent of each other, you may be able to receive both without any reduction in your paid leave benefits.


You may not receive paid family or medical leave benefits and use paid sick time through your employer at the same time. If you choose to use employer sick time while you are taking paid leave, your approved benefit amount may be reduced in order to offset benefits.


You cannot use accrued Floating Holidays on the same days that you are receiving paid benefits from PFML. It is important to communicate to both your employer and DFML as to when you plan to use your accrued paid leave (Floating Holidays) while you need to be out of work. 

 

For more information, https://www.mass.gov/info-details/how-other-leave-and-benefits-can-affect-your-paid-family-and-medical-leave

Workers Compensation

Inform your supervisor immediately. Our insurance pays for any reasonable and necessary medical treatment related to a job-related injury or illness, pays compensation for lost wages after the first five calendar days of full or partial disability, and in some cases provides retraining for employees who qualify.
